slothful
英['sləʊθfl] 美['sloʊθfl]
单词基本解释
adj.怠惰的;懒惰的;迟钝的

副词::slothfully

名词::slothfulness

英英释义
Adjective:
  1. disinclined to work or exertion;

    "faineant kings under whose rule the country languished"
    "an indolent hanger-on"
    "too lazy to wash the dishes"
    "shiftless idle youth"
    "slothful employees"
    "the unemployed are not necessarily work-shy"
